摘要
九龙江是福建第二大河流,其中北溪(龙岩段)的水环境质量对龙岩地区的经济和民生起着至关重要的作用。本文着重应用熵权法计算了化学指标pH、DO、COD_(Mn)、BOD_(5)、NH_(3)^(-)N、TP的权重,采用《地表水环境质量标准(GB3838-2002)》结合TOPSIS模型法对2018年九龙江北溪(龙岩段)8个监测断面的地表水环境质量进行评价。结果表明:2018年九龙江北溪龙岩境内各断面水质均在Ⅲ类以上,评价为优良(梧地桥>渡头>涵口村>Ⅰ类>九鹏溪口>溪南溪口>泽源电站>进庄大桥>Ⅱ类>雁石桥>Ⅲ类>Ⅳ类>Ⅴ类)。
Jiulong River is the second largest river in Fujian province.The water quality of Beixi(Longyan)of this river plays a vital role in local economy and people's livelihood.In this study,the weight of pH,DO,COD_(Mn),BOD_(5),NH_(3)^(-)N and TP was calculated through entropy weight method,respectively.Referring to Surface Water Environmental Quality Standard(GB3838-2002),real-time data of eight monitored sections in 2018 were evaluated by using Entropy Weight-TOPSIS model method.The results shows that the water quality of all selected sections in 2018 is above Class Ⅲ and is all evaluated as excellent(Wudi Bridge>Dudou>Hankou Village>Class Ⅰ>Jiupeng Xikou>Xinan Xikou>Zeyuan Power Station>Jinzhuang Bridge>Class Ⅱ>Yanshi Bridge>Class Ⅲ>Class Ⅳ>Class Ⅴ).
